Common Health Issues and Preventive Care

Early detection and proactive measures are essential for minimizing health problems. Regular check-ups and a watchful eye can help prevent many common issues.

  • Parasites: Fleas, ticks, and heartworms are common parasites that can cause discomfort and health issues. Preventative measures, such as topical medications and regular parasite checks, are vital.
  • Dental Problems: Dental issues, like gum disease and tooth decay, are prevalent in pets. Regular dental care, including brushing and professional cleanings, can help prevent these problems.
  • Allergies: Allergies can cause skin irritation, itching, and other discomfort. Identifying and managing potential allergens, such as certain foods or environmental factors, is important.
  • Obesity: Obesity is a growing concern for pets. Maintaining a healthy weight through proper diet and exercise can prevent numerous health issues. Consult with your veterinarian for tailored recommendations.

Common Emergency Pet Situations

A variety of conditions can necessitate emergency veterinary care. Some of the most frequent causes of pet emergencies include:

  • Trauma, such as car accidents, falls, or fights. These incidents can result in broken bones, lacerations, or internal injuries.
  • Poisoning, which can arise from ingestion of toxic substances. Knowing the potential dangers in your home and environment can help prevent these incidents.
  • Respiratory distress, which might be caused by allergic reactions, foreign objects, or infections. Rapid breathing, coughing, or difficulty breathing are common symptoms.
  • Seizures, often indicating underlying neurological conditions. Rapid, involuntary movements, loss of consciousness, and behavioral changes are typical.
  • Gastrointestinal issues, such as severe vomiting or diarrhea. These can lead to dehydration and electrolyte imbalances, especially in young animals or those with underlying health conditions.
  • Heatstroke, particularly common during hot weather. Excessive panting, difficulty breathing, high body temperature, and neurological changes are possible indicators.
  • Sudden onset of lameness or pain. This could indicate a variety of musculoskeletal or joint problems. Immediate attention is critical to minimize further damage and prevent complications.
